The London Dungeon

The London Dungeon is the ultimate haunted house. It has areas that tell about various times in London history where real-life events were extremely scary such as...

The torture chambers

The Great Plaque,

A boat ride through Traitor's Gate (see entry on Tower of London),


Sweeny Todd (the Barber on Fleet street who killed his victims and gave the meat to his wife to bake in pies for sale),

Jack the Ripper (see previous entry),

& The Great Fire of 1666
